AIB office development, Dublin

AIB office development, Dublin

Architect: Robinson Keefe & Devane
Main contractor: John Sisk & Son
Ceiling sub-contractor: Oakleaf Contracts
Type of works: supply of 500 x 500mm perforated clip-in tiles, bespoke bulkhead panels and light boxes.

In the early 1970’s, AIB relocated their headquarters to Merrion Road in Ballsbridge. The development was one of the country's first campus style business complexes. In 2003, Robinson Keefe & Devane were appointed as the architects for a new building project. The brief was to design office accommodation to effectively double the population of the bank centre from approx 2,000 to 4,000 employees.
